Charlottenberg Station (Norwegian: Charlottenberg stasjon, Swedish: Charlottenberg station) is a railway station located on the Kongsvinger Line and the Värmland Line at Charlottenberg in Eda, Sweden. The station is located 5 kilometers (3.1 mi) from the Norway–Sweden border and was opened in 1865[1] for changing crew on international trains between Sweden and Norway.
